add vjp test with non-contig inputs (#89375)
Ref: https://github.com/pytorch/functorch/issues/1029
We update `test_vjp` to do contiguous and non-contiguous sample testing.
Prev Time: ~32s
New Time : ~50s
Pull Request resolved: https://github.com/pytorch/pytorch/pull/89375
Approved by: https://github.com/zou3519